Beyond the Surface: Sustainable Packaging and Ethical Considerations in Beauty

The beauty industry is at a pivotal moment, with increasing consumer demand for products that are both effective and environmentally responsible. Sustainable packaging is a key driver of this change, and this session will explore the latest innovations and challenges in creating eco-friendly solutions.

We will delve into cutting-edge materials, circular economy models, and strategies for minimizing packaging’s environmental impact. Simultaneously, we will address the crucial link between sustainable packaging and ethical sourcing, examining how responsible material procurement and fair labor practices contribute to a truly sustainable beauty industry.

Join us as we explore actionable strategies for beauty brands and packaging suppliers to create a more responsible and transparent future.

Dhitaya Thanomwong is a recognized expert in packaging development & design, innovation, and sustainability, with over 30 years of experience leading global initiatives for brands such as Johnson & Johnson, Unilever and Colgate-Palmolive. She has driven packaging strategies for personal care, home care, and cosmetic products across the Asia-Pacific region—delivering solutions that combine functionality, aesthetics, and environmental responsibility.

Dhitaya is known for advancing circular design, material innovation, and sustainable supply chain practices. She works closely with marketing and design teams to create packaging that enhances both brand identity and the consumer experience.

Since 2014, she has served as a guest lecturer at Kasetsart University, teaching global cosmetic and luxury packaging development strategy with a focus on design thinking, materials, and sustainable technologies.

With a collaborative and inclusive leadership style, Dhitaya has built and led cross-functional teams in Thailand, Vietnam, Malaysia, the Philippines, Turkey, and Australia. Today, she continues to inspire the industry as a mentor, speaker, and strategic advisor—championing ethical and sustainable packaging as a key driver of innovation and brand value in the beauty and personal care world.

Denice Sy is the Chief Sales and Marketing Officer (CSMO) for Ever Bilena Cosmetics, Inc. (EBCI). Before joining Ever Bilena, she graduated with honors from University of California Berkeley in 2014 where she obtained a simultaneous degree in B.S. Business Administration at the Haas School of Business and B.A. South & Southeast Asian Studies. She was also a recipient of the prestigious Fashion Scholarship Fund in New York, and is currently a regular lifestyle columnist at Manila Bulletin.

As the CSMO of EBCI, the company behind beauty brands Ever Bilena, Careline, Spotlight Cosmetics, Hello Glow, Ever Organics, Hyaloo and Blackwater, Denice has a bold vision of elevating Filipino beauty across all categories, market segments, and retail channels. Ever Bilena is the #1 local color cosmetics brand in the country, and aims to continuously innovate and expand its product portfolio and reach for every beauty.
